Bi-colour LEDs incorporate two distinct LED emitters in one case. There's two sorts of these. 1 type is made of two dies connected to the same two potential customers antiparallel to one another. Current move in a single way emits just one shade, and recent in the other course emits the opposite coloration.

Two further enhancements, formulated inside the 1990s, are LEDs dependant on aluminum gallium indium phosphide, which emit mild competently from inexperienced to red-orange, and likewise blue-emitting LEDs depending on silicon carbide or gallium nitride.
Sensible basic lighting desires large-ability LEDs, of one watt or more. Standard running currents for these equipment get started at 350 mA.
At present, in the area of phosphor LED development, A great deal exertion is currently being spent on optimizing these devices to greater mild output and higher Procedure temperatures. By way of example, the effectiveness is usually lifted by adapting greater package deal style or by making use of a far more ideal form of phosphor. Conformal coating approach is regularly utilized to deal with The difficulty of various phosphor thickness.[citation required]
Phosphor-centered LEDs have efficiency losses on account of warmth loss from your Stokes shift as well as other phosphor-relevant challenges. Their luminous efficacies in comparison with usual LEDs depend on the spectral distribution in the resultant gentle output and the first wavelength of the LED by itself.
